Transaction 62affaa3a89e47468e0c284e511e529a24ea41eb5306a8c4a8bbabe6eb25ff30

1 Input
1 Outputs
  • 62affaa3a89e47468e0c284e511e529a24ea41eb5306a8c4a8bbabe6eb25ff30:0
  • value  1605013
    address  37KciR82EB8XsntTy5sLX9rZTnWpcFzWPj